The rear brake SHIMANO MT420 allows you to benefit from the Japanese manufacturer's design quality, at a very competitive price! This high-performance model, ideal for leisure mountain biking, can be used on all types of outings (from the Hiking to All Mountain). Simple and practical to install, it is supplied here in a Junction-Kit designed above all for frames with internal ducting.

The lever allows two-finger braking, while the reach adjustment is suitable for small hands. It also features an additional contact point on the handlebars to stiffen the assembly and ensure a precise feel.

As for the BR-MT420 caliper, it's based on a reliable, powerful four-piston system in two different sizes. It features a reliable design, engineered for a smooth attack of the pads on the disc, but also to ensure a large contact surface for reduced noise, a clean feel and easy power metering.

Installation of J-Kit brakes:
- Position your brake lever on the bike handlebars
- Mount your brake caliper on the fork and/or frame
- Route the brake hose through the internal passage in your frame (if your bike is so equipped).
- Remove the black rubber plug from the end of the hose
- Remove the yellow end caps from the brake levers.
- Slide the black rubber nut cover over the hose
- Do not remove the small white cap from the end of the hose.
- Insert brake hose into lever nut
- Keeping the hose at the bottom of the lever nut, tighten the nut to compress the olive inside the lever. There's no need to overtighten, as the nut thread should remain visible, and is then masked by the nut cover you slid over the hose earlier.
- Now you can operate the brake to finalize its installation.

PM = Postmount
IS = International Standard Mounting
If the spacing between the two caliper mounting bolts (on frame or fork) is 74mm, this corresponds to a PM mounting. If the spacing is 51mm, it's an IS mounting.
